Associate Product Manager - Parametric

Remote · USA Full-time New today

Morgan Stanley is a leading global financial services firm providing a wide range of investment banking, securities, wealth management and investment management services. The Associate Product Manager role at Parametric involves supporting the planning, coordination, and execution of critical initiatives within Product Management, collaborating with internal stakeholders to ensure effective project planning and communication.

Responsibilities

  • Support effective teamwork, prioritization, communication, and collaboration across multiple groups with competing priorities, while maintaining strong working relationships and ensuring follow-through on agreed actions
  • Partner with Product Managers, internal teams, and MSIM stakeholders to support execution across the full product lifecycle, including new product development, NPA approvals, seed capital coordination, and ongoing product oversight, while tracking requirements, timelines, and deliverables
  • Support the department’s technology initiatives by partnering with internal teams to evaluate and help implement tools that enhance Product Management efficiency. Contribute to initiatives focused on improving technology adoption, integrating Artificial Intelligence and automation into workflows, and supporting teams as they adopt new capabilities. Maintain awareness of new tools and trends that streamline processes and improve data quality and decision making
  • Support the Product department in managing complexities related to the creation, implementation, and execution of Parametric products by assisting with coordination, documentation, and analysis
  • Support leadership readiness by anticipating questions, synthesizing complex information, and preparing clear, well‑structured materials for senior stakeholders
  • Assist in the maintenance and development of competitive data resources, including updating data sets, validating inputs, and preparing summaries for stakeholders
  • Support the design, documentation, testing, and implementation of new processes to streamline Product Management workflows; create, maintain, and distribute recurring department updates
  • Compile, review, and analyze product data and dashboard metrics from various internal and external sources to measure performance and outcomes, highlight trends, and identify areas for follow up
  • Explore and integrate Artificial Intelligence tools into daily tasks and process improvements under the direction of senior team members
  • Collaborate with Product Managers and stakeholders to prepare for quarterly, annual, and ad hoc meetings, including agenda development, material preparation, and meeting logistics
  • Build specialized knowledge of Parametric products and cultivate relationships with internal subject matter experts across Parametric and MSIM
  • Gain a comprehensive understanding of the firm’s structure, key personnel, and organizational policies
  • Develop subject matter expertise and serve as a knowledgeable point of contact for assigned projects and routine department wide requests
  • Identify potential bottlenecks and risks, escalate issues as appropriate, and balance competing priorities in partnership with senior team members
  • Perform additional responsibilities as needed
